Abstract

The utility model discloses an anti-fatigue electric competition chair capable of protecting spine, which comprises a cushion, wherein the rear end of the cushion is fixedly connected with a backrest, the left end and the right end of the cushion are fixedly connected with side plates, the top ends of the side plates are fixedly connected with armrests, the left side and the right side of the bottom end of the cushion are fixedly connected with slide rails, the bottom ends of the slide rails are respectively and slidably connected with slide blocks, the middle parts of the front ends of the slide blocks are respectively and fixedly connected with telescopic rods, and the front ends of the telescopic rods are respectively and fixedly connected with the left end and the right end of a damping rotating shaft. According to the utility model, the backrest, the cushion and the headrest all accord with the ergonomic design, so that the comfort level of a user is improved, the spine can be protected, the health of the human body is greatly benefited, feet are placed on the foot pad, the user can conveniently rest, the comfort level of the user is greatly improved, the fatigue of the user can be relieved, after the foot pad is used, the foot pad is rotated downwards, the foot pad is pushed backwards, and the foot pad is collected below the cushion, so that the foot pad is convenient to store, and the foot pad is worth of being widely popularized.

Referring to fig. 1-3, one embodiment of the present invention is provided: an anti-fatigue electric competition chair capable of protecting the spine comprises a cushion 1, wherein the rear end of the cushion 1 is fixedly connected with a backrest 4, the left and right ends of the cushion 1 are fixedly connected with side plates 6, the top ends of the side plates 6 are fixedly connected with handrails 5, the left and right sides of the bottom end of the cushion 1 are fixedly connected with slide rails 7, the bottom ends of the slide rails 7 are respectively and slidably connected with slide blocks 13, the middle parts of the front ends of the slide blocks 13 are respectively and fixedly connected with telescopic rods 14, the front ends of the telescopic rods 14 are respectively and fixedly connected with the left and right ends of a damping rotating shaft 15, the middle part of the bottom end of the cushion 1 is fixedly connected with a strut 8, the bottom end of the strut 8 is fixedly connected with the top end of a base 11, the periphery of the base 11 is uniformly and fixedly connected with a plurality of support rods 9, the upper and lower sides of the inner wall of the left end of the backrest 4 are respectively and fixedly connected with a motor 18, the driving ends of the motor 18 are respectively and fixedly connected with a transmission shaft 20, a roller 19 is fixedly connected on the transmission shaft 20, and works through the motor 18, drive transmission shaft 20 and rotate for cylinder 19 rotates, thereby makes massage ball 17 massage user's back, massages the user, sets up through spring 21 and cushion 22, improves this electricity and competes the comfort level of chair, and rethread back 4, cushion 1 and headrest 3 all accord with the human engineering design, have improved user's comfort level, can protect the vertebra simultaneously, have very big benefit to human health.
The front end of the backrest 4 is provided with a ventilation groove 16 which is convenient for ventilation and perspiration, the front ends of the armrests 5 are fixedly connected with sleeves 2 which can be used for placing a water cup, the shaft body of the damping rotating shaft 15 is rotatably connected with a foot pad 12, the outer sides of the bottom ends of the supporting rods 9 are fixedly connected with rollers 10, the shaft body of the roller 19 is uniformly and fixedly connected with a plurality of massage balls 17, the inner walls of the front end and the rear end of the backrest 4 are fixedly connected with soft pads 22, the two soft pads 22 are connected through springs 21, the top end of the backrest 4 is fixedly connected with a headrest 3, the foot pad 12 is pulled forwards to enable the sliding block 13 to slide forwards along the sliding rail 7, after the front end of the sliding rail 7 is reached, the foot pad 12 is continuously pulled, the telescopic rod 14 can be continuously lengthened, the foot pad 12 is rotated, the foot pad 12 can be adjusted to a proper position, feet can be placed on the foot pad 12, a user can conveniently rest, the comfort level of the user is greatly improved, and fatigue of the user can be relieved, after the use, the foot pad 12 is rotated downwards, the foot pad 12 is pushed backwards, and the foot pad 12 is collected below the seat cushion 1 and is convenient to store.
The working principle is as follows: firstly, the motor 18 works to drive the transmission shaft 20 to rotate, the roller 19 rotates, thereby the massage ball 17 massages the back of a user, the user is massaged, the comfort level of the electronic competition chair is improved by arranging the spring 21 and the soft cushion 22, then the backrest 4, the cushion 1 and the headrest 3 all conform to the ergonomic design, the comfort level of the user is improved, meanwhile, the spine can be protected, great benefits are provided for the health of the human body, when in rest, the foot pad 12 is pulled forwards, the sliding block 13 slides forwards along the sliding rail 7, after reaching the front end of the sliding rail 7, the foot pad 12 is pulled continuously, the telescopic rod 14 can be extended continuously, the foot pad 12 is rotated, the foot pad 12 can be adjusted to a proper position, the foot is placed on the foot pad 12, the rest of the user is facilitated, the comfort level of the user is greatly improved, the fatigue of the user can be relieved, after the use, the foot pad 12 is rotated downwards, the foot pad 12 is pushed backwards and is collected below the cushion 1, so that the storage is convenient.
